How much do remote office j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ote office in Spring, TX is $45,808.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$35,600.00 and $52,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ced in a Remote Office role?

One common challenge in a Remote Office role is maintaining clear communication with team members across different locations and time zones, which requires proactive use of collaboration platforms and regular check-ins. Ensuring productivity and work-life balance can also be difficult without the structure of a traditional office. Additionally, troubleshooting technical issues independently and staying updated on company policies in a remote environment may take extra initiative. Employers often provide training and resources to help remote office staff stay connected and supported, making adaptability and problem-solving skills highly valuable for success in this position.

What is a Remote Office job?

A Remote Office job refers to a position where employees work from a location outside of a traditional office, such as their home or a co-working space. These roles rely on digital tools and communication platforms to collaborate with team members and complete tasks. Remote Office jobs offer flexibility and eliminate commuting but require self-discipline and a reliable internet connection. Many companies now offer remote work options to attract talent and improve work-life balance.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Remote Office position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a Remote Office role, you need strong organizational skills, proficiency with office software, and experience in virtual communication and collaboration. Familiarity with tools like Microsoft Office Suite, cloud storage platforms, and remote project management systems is typically required. Reliability, self-motivation, and excellent time management are important soft skills that help ensure efficiency while working independently. These abilities are essential for maintaining seamless operations and productivity when working outside a traditional office environment.
